The cheapest way to get from Chiasso to Verbier is to drive which costs SFr 40 - SFr 60 and takes 4h 2m.
The fastest way to get from Chiasso to Verbier is to drive which takes 4h 2m and costs SFr 40 - SFr 60.
No, there is no direct train from Chiasso to Verbier. However, there are services departing from Chiasso and arriving at Verbier via Milano Centrale, Martigny and Le Châble TV.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h.
The distance between Chiasso and Verbier is 309 km. The road distance is 248.1 km.
The best way to get from Chiasso to Verbier without a car is to train which takes 6h and costs SFr 70 - SFr 170.
It takes approximately 6h to get from Chiasso to Verbier, including transfers.
